#cf990e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f990e is composed of 81.2% red, 60%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#cf990e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1c with #9f3300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#cf990e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f990e has RGB values of R:207, G:153,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.93,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13605134.

Hex triplet cf990e #cf990e
RGB Decimal 207, 153, 14 rgb(207,153,14)
RGB Percent 81.2, 60, 5.5 rgb(81.2%,60%,5.5%)
CMYK 0, 26, 93, 19
HSL 43.2°, 87.3, 43.3 hsl(43.2,87.3%,43.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 43.2°, 93.2, 81.2
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 66.582, 9.792, 68.81
XYZ 37.203, 36.082, 5.421
xyY 0.473, 0.458, 36.082
CIE-LCH 66.582, 69.503, 81.901
CIE-LUV 66.582, 45.354, 67.273
Hunter-Lab 60.068, 5.436, 36.697
Binary 11001111, 10011001, 00001110

Shades and Tints of #cf990e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050400 is the darkest color, while #fefbf2 is the lightest one.
